Luke Romano (born 16 February 1986) is a New Zealand rugby union footballer who plays as a lock for the Crusaders in Super Rugby[1] and Canterbury in the ITM Cup.[2] He is a key member of 2015 Rugby World Cup winning team.

Romano is a New Zealand international, making his debut on 23 June 2012 in a 60–0 win against Ireland in Hamilton. He currently has 11 caps and has scored 1 try.[3][4] He is of Italian descent.[5]
